                    103: #define min(a, b) ((a) < (b) ? (a) : (b))
                    104: #define max(a, b) ((a) > (b) ? (a) : (b))
                    105: 
                    106: #include "environ.h"
                    107: 
                    108: /* Return a new environment object.  */
                    109: 
                    110: struct environ *
                    111: make_environ ()
                    112: {
                    113:   register struct environ *e;
                    114: 
                    115:   e = (struct environ *) xmalloc (sizeof (struct environ));
                    116: 
                    117:   e->allocated = 10;
                    118:   e->vector = (char **) xmalloc ((e->allocated + 1) * sizeof (char *));
                    119:   e->vector[0] = 0;
                    120:   return e;
                    121: }
                    122: 
                    123: /* Free an environment and all the strings in it.  */
                    124: 
                    125: void
                    126: free_environ (e)
                    127:      register struct environ *e;
                    128: {
                    129:   register char **vector = e->vector;
                    130: 
                    131:   while (*vector)
                    132:     free (*vector++);
                    133: 
                    134:   free (e);
                    135: }
                    136: 
                    137: /* Copy the environment given to this process into E.
                    138:    Also copies all the strings in it, so we can be sure
                    139:    that all strings in these environments are safe to free.  */
                    140: 
                    141: void
                    142: init_environ (e)
                    143:      register struct environ *e;
                    144: {
                    145:   extern char **environ;
                    146:   register int i;
                    147: 
                    148:   for (i = 0; environ[i]; i++);
                    149: 
                    150:   if (e->allocated < i)
                    151:     {
                    152:       e->allocated = max (i, e->allocated + 10);
                    153:       e->vector = (char **) xrealloc (e->vector,
                    154:                                      (e->allocated + 1) * sizeof (char *));
                    155:     }
                    156: 
                    157:   bcopy (environ, e->vector, (i + 1) * sizeof (char *));
                    158: 
                    159:   while (--i >= 0)
                    160:     {
                    161:       register int len = strlen (e->vector[i]);
                    162:       register char *new = (char *) xmalloc (len + 1);
                    163:       bcopy (e->vector[i], new, len);
                    164:       e->vector[i] = new;
                    165:     }
                    166: }
                    167: 
                    168: /* Return the vector of environment E.
                    169:    This is used to get something to pass to execve.  */
                    170: 
                    171: char **
                    172: environ_vector (e)
                    173:      struct environ *e;
                    174: {
                    175:   return e->vector;
                    176: }
                    177: 
                    178: /* Return the value in environment E of variable VAR.  */
                    179: 
                    180: char *
                    181: get_in_environ (e, var)
                    182:      struct environ *e;
                    183:      char *var;
                    184: {
                    185:   register int len = strlen (var);
                    186:   register char **vector = e->vector;
                    187:   register char *s;
                    188: 
                    189:   for (; s = *vector; vector++)
                    190:     if (!strncmp (s, var, len)
                    191:        && s[len] == '=')
                    192:       return &s[len + 1];
                    193: 
                    194:   return 0;
                    195: }
                    196: 
                    197: /* Store the value in E of VAR as VALUE.  */
                    198: 
                    199: void
                    200: set_in_environ (e, var, value)
                    201:      struct environ *e;
                    202:      char *var;
                    203:      char *value;
                    204: {
                    205:   register int i;
                    206:   register int len = strlen (var);
                    207:   register char **vector = e->vector;
                    208:   register char *s;
                    209: 
                    210:   for (i = 0; s = vector[i]; i++)
                    211:     if (!strncmp (s, var, len)
                    212:        && s[len] == '=')
                    213:       break;
                    214: 
                    215:   if (s == 0)
                    216:     {
                    217:       if (i == e->allocated)
                    218:        {
                    219:          e->allocated += 10;
                    220:          vector = (char **) xrealloc (vector,
                    221:                                       (e->allocated + 1) * sizeof (char *));
                    222:          e->vector = vector;
                    223:        }
                    224:       vector[i + 1] = 0;
                    225:     }
                    226:   else
                    227:     free (s);
                    228: 
                    229:   s = (char *) xmalloc (len + strlen (value) + 2);
                    230:   strcpy (s, var);
                    231:   strcat (s, "=");
                    232:   strcat (s, value);
                    233:   vector[i] = s;
                    234:   return;
                    235: }
                    236: 
                    237: /* Remove the setting for variable VAR from environment E.  */
                    238: 
                    239: void
                    240: unset_in_environ (e, var)
                    241:      struct environ *e;
                    242:      char *var;
                    243: {
                    244:   register int len = strlen (var);
                    245:   register char **vector = e->vector;
                    246:   register char *s;
                    247: 
                    248:   for (; s = *vector; vector++)
                    249:     if (!strncmp (s, var, len)
                    250:        && s[len] == '=')
                    251:       {
                    252:        free (s);
                    253:        bcopy (vector + 1, vector,
                    254:               (e->allocated - (vector - e->vector)) * sizeof (char *));
                    255:        e->vector[e->allocated - 1] = 0;
                    256:        return;
                    257:       }
                    258: }
